Lines Matching refs:dsi

92 		      struct mipi_dsi_device *dsi);
94 struct mipi_dsi_device *dsi);
254 * @dsi: DSI peripheral
256 int mipi_dsi_attach(struct mipi_dsi_device *dsi);
260 * @dsi: DSI peripheral
262 int mipi_dsi_detach(struct mipi_dsi_device *dsi);
263 int mipi_dsi_shutdown_peripheral(struct mipi_dsi_device *dsi);
264 int mipi_dsi_turn_on_peripheral(struct mipi_dsi_device *dsi);
265 int mipi_dsi_set_maximum_return_packet_size(struct mipi_dsi_device *dsi,
268 ssize_t mipi_dsi_generic_write(struct mipi_dsi_device *dsi, const void *payload,
270 ssize_t mipi_dsi_generic_read(struct mipi_dsi_device *dsi, const void *params,
293 * @dsi: DSI peripheral device
303 ssize_t mipi_dsi_dcs_write_buffer(struct mipi_dsi_device *dsi,
308 * @dsi: DSI peripheral device
318 ssize_t mipi_dsi_dcs_write(struct mipi_dsi_device *dsi, u8 cmd,
323 * @dsi: DSI peripheral device
330 ssize_t mipi_dsi_dcs_read(struct mipi_dsi_device *dsi, u8 cmd, void *data,
335 * @dsi: DSI peripheral device
339 int mipi_dsi_dcs_nop(struct mipi_dsi_device *dsi);
343 * @dsi: DSI peripheral device
347 int mipi_dsi_dcs_soft_reset(struct mipi_dsi_device *dsi);
352 * @dsi: DSI peripheral device
357 int mipi_dsi_dcs_get_power_mode(struct mipi_dsi_device *dsi, u8 *mode);
362 * @dsi: DSI peripheral device
367 int mipi_dsi_dcs_get_pixel_format(struct mipi_dsi_device *dsi, u8 *format);
372 * @dsi: DSI peripheral device
376 int mipi_dsi_dcs_enter_sleep_mode(struct mipi_dsi_device *dsi);
381 * @dsi: DSI peripheral device
385 int mipi_dsi_dcs_exit_sleep_mode(struct mipi_dsi_device *dsi);
390 * @dsi: DSI peripheral device
394 int mipi_dsi_dcs_set_display_off(struct mipi_dsi_device *dsi);
399 * @dsi: DSI peripheral device
403 int mipi_dsi_dcs_set_display_on(struct mipi_dsi_device *dsi);
408 * @dsi: DSI peripheral device
414 int mipi_dsi_dcs_set_column_address(struct mipi_dsi_device *dsi, u16 start,
419 * @dsi: DSI peripheral device
425 int mipi_dsi_dcs_set_page_address(struct mipi_dsi_device *dsi, u16 start,
431 * @dsi: DSI peripheral device
435 int mipi_dsi_dcs_set_tear_off(struct mipi_dsi_device *dsi);
440 * @dsi: DSI peripheral device
445 int mipi_dsi_dcs_set_tear_on(struct mipi_dsi_device *dsi,
451 * @dsi: DSI peripheral device
456 int mipi_dsi_dcs_set_pixel_format(struct mipi_dsi_device *dsi, u8 format);
461 * @dsi: DSI peripheral device
466 int mipi_dsi_dcs_set_tear_scanline(struct mipi_dsi_device *dsi, u16 scanline);
471 * @dsi: DSI peripheral device
476 int mipi_dsi_dcs_set_display_brightness(struct mipi_dsi_device *dsi,
482 * @dsi: DSI peripheral device
487 int mipi_dsi_dcs_get_display_brightness(struct mipi_dsi_device *dsi,